Atmosfäärikindlus
Atmosfäärikindlus is a term that describes the ability of a material, structure, or object to withstand the effects of atmospheric conditions over time. These conditions include a wide range of environmental factors such as temperature fluctuations, humidity, precipitation (rain, snow, hail), sunlight (UV radiation), wind, and exposure to pollutants like salt spray or industrial emissions. Materials with good atmosfäärikindlus will degrade, corrode, or otherwise lose their functional or aesthetic properties at a significantly slower rate when exposed to these elements.
